Tax Return rejected due to Reject Code 5695_Joint_Occupancy

I just filed my daughter's Federal and State (Colorado) tax returns but they were rejected with the error, "Reject Code 5695_Joint_Occupancy".  There is a check box, line 32a, in form 5695 which says, "If the special rule for joint occupants applies, check here and attach a statement". This box is checked, no matter what and I think it is the reason for the problem. The property is jointly owned (two people), but all the energy improvements as it relates to this credit were paid by my daughter. If I understand the IRS instructions of form 5695, I think Line 32a with the checkbox, has to do with lines 7a through 7c of PARTI of the form which is the "Residential Clean Energy Credit". She did not have any credits on that section. The only credits she had was in PART II, the "Energy Efficient Home Improvement Credit". This is why I think the TurboTax program has a bug that needs to be fixed. Can someone please tell me if my assessment is wrong and if so then how do I go about fixing this error so I can e-file the returns?

Tax Return rejected due to Reject Code 5695_Joint_Occupancy

There is information that returns that have been rejected with the reject code 5695_Joint_Occupancy will not be able to be electronically filed until after mid-March.  

 

You may wait until then to electronically file your return or choose to file it by mail.  Another option would be to remove the energy credit, electronically file the returns, and later amend to add the energy credit back for the additional refund.
